Modern dance improvisation is a form of dance where dancers create movements spontaneously without predetermined choreography.

Key Features

  • Spontaneous movement creation
  • Emphasis on individual expression
  • Exploration of unique movement vocabulary

Pros

  • Encourages creativity and self-expression
  • Allows for individual interpretation and style
  • Promotes spontaneity and freedom of movement

Cons

  • May be challenging for those used to structured choreography
  • Requires a certain level of confidence and comfort with improvisation
